Ismellsmoke_small In this hour of The Blues & Beyond, we'll hear from two great artists who passed away this month, bluesman Michael Burks and bassist Donald "Duck" Dunn. Michael Burks, known as "The Iron Man," was a soulful singer and dazzling guitarist who suffered a heart attack in the airport in Atlanta after returning from a tour in Europe. Bassist Donald "Duck" Dunn was a mainstay of the Memphis soul scene, a member The Mar-Keys, and of Booker T & The MGs, and bassist on classic recordings by Sam & Dave, Otis Redding, Albert King, Muddy Waters, and many others. He died in Japan after a show there. We'll also hear new blues from Quintus McCormick, and open a new album from John Pizzarelli on which he combines songs in medleys that were written decades - - and styles - - apart.
